Which database are you speaking of?
I can think of two options:
1. Saving the path of the music files in the database and then loading the files in the player from that path.
2. Saving the file as a Blob in the database and reading and playing them through your app."No matter how many fish in the sea; it will be so empty without me." - From song "Without me" by Eminem

Tridip Bhattacharjee wrote: how to query address field in my xml or how to query Options field,how query CompanyOrName.
A XML-query will look somewhat more complicated then a "regular" query. I hope that the example below provides a good impression of the used construct;
DECLARE @ShipXML XML
SET @ShipXML =
'<OpenShipments>
<OpenShipment>
<NumberOfPackages>1</NumberOfPackages>
<ShipmentActualWeight>5</ShipmentActualWeight>
<DescriptionOfGoods>Car Parts</DescriptionOfGoods>
</OpenShipment>
<OpenShipment>
<NumberOfPackages>2</NumberOfPackages>
<ShipmentActualWeight>3</ShipmentActualWeight>
<DescriptionOfGoods>Bike Parts</DescriptionOfGoods>
</OpenShipment>
</OpenShipments>'
SELECT shs.sh.value('NumberOfPackages[1]','bigint') AS NumberOfPackages
,shs.sh.value('ShipmentActualWeight[1]','bigint') AS ShipmentActualWeight
,shs.sh.value('DescriptionOfGoods[1]','varchar(20)') AS DescriptionOfGoods
FROM @ShipXML.nodes('OpenShipments/OpenShipment') shs(sh)
WHERE shs.sh.exist('.[DescriptionOfGoods != "Car Parts"]') = 1 The example was built using sample-code from MSDN[^].I are Troll

One of the (minor) reasons we dumped (on) Crystal was the export to excel was so crappy.
We use SSRS and the excel export is one hell of a lot better than Crystal used to be. Having said that SSIS does not support data dumps, it shouldn't it is a REPORTING tool. I repeat this line to my management weekly, it does not help. They still insist that data dumps are a requirement.
So one of our devs has extended SSRS to export csv files via RS. This is not possible in CR and is pretty ugly even in SSRS, it means hacking the UI to a custom page that calls a stored proc that writes the file to a folder and then displays a link for the user to download the file. As I said ugly, but it works without having to pull major volume to the UI to export.Never underestimate the power of human stupidity
